NYU Gets $50M in Sandy Recovery Gift
NYU Langone Medical Center announced Friday a $50 million gift from cosmetics tycoon Ronald Perelman to expand the emergency department that was battered by Superstorm Sandy. The 22,000-square-foot Perelman Emergency Center will more than triple the size of the old emergency department. It is due to open in April.
